私はいくつかのテストを実行するためにselenium-clientを使用していますが、Seleniumは開発データベースを使用しているようです。テストDBを使用するにはどうすればいいですか?セレンにテストデータベースを使用するよう指示する方法はありますか?
4
A
答えて
4
テストデータベースを使用するサイトにSeleniumを指す必要があります。セレンはデータベースではなく、あなたのレールに向かって話します。だから、あなたの設定があなたのテストのデータベースを指しているdevのdbを指していないWebアプリケーションにSeleniumを指す必要があります。
希望に役立ちます。
0
テストデータベースを使用するアプリケーションのインスタンスでSeleniumテストを指す必要があります。
capistrano deploy.rbに別のデプロイメントタスクを書いて、テストサーバーにアプリケーションをデプロイし、テスト用のデータベースにポイントし、セレン固有のフィクスチャをロードします。 Seleniumは、デプロイされたアプリケーションをブラックボックスとして処理するので、既存のデプロイメント設定にすべて合わせることはあなた次第です。
関連する問題
- 1. コンパイルに別のバイナリをg ++に使用するように指示する方法はありますか?
- 2. aptanaに複数のftp接続を使用するよう指示する方法はありますか?
- 3. webbrowserに「スタック」しているスクリプトを続行するように指示する方法はありますか?
- 4. jenkinsに展開後にTomcatを再起動するように指示する方法はありますか?
- 5. Qtネットワークに発信ネットワークインターフェイスを変更するように指示する方法はありますか?
- 6. Facebook共有者に画像を無視するように指示する方法はありますか?
- 7. gitにファイルの特定の行を無視するように指示する方法はありますか?
- 8. MVCにaspxまたはascxをキャッシュしないように指示する方法はありますか?
- 9. ムービークリップをタイル/ストレッチしてウィンドウ全体をカバーするように指示する方法はありますか?
- 10. Int32としてInt32を扱うように64ビットGHCに指示する方法はありますか?
- 11. 特定のパッケージのテストをスキップするように指示する方法はありますか?
- 12. MavenにJAVA_HOMEで指定されたJDK以外のJDKを使用するように指示する方法はありますか?
- 13. Visual Studioを使用するようにsetup.pyに指示する方法
- 14. 要求にセキュリティを使用するようにWCFに指示する方法はありますが、応答では無視しますか?
- 15. サーバがHTTP応答から時間を稼ぐように指示する方法はありますか?
- 16. メッセージを再試行しないようにNServiceBusに指示する方法はありますか?
- 17. `ConcurrentDictionary.GetOrAdd`に値を追加しないように指示する方法はありますか?
- 18. automakeにautomakefileの一部を解釈させないように指示する方法はありますか?
- 19. nHibernateにテーブルの重複エントリを許可しないように指示する方法はありますか?
- 20. WebBrowserコンポーネントに元のHTMLを変更しないように指示する方法はありますか?
- 21. Signed OAuthリクエストを使用するようコントローラ仕様に指示する方法
- 22. カピバラでテストデータベースを使用するには?
- 23. 常にwxFileConfigを使用するようにwxWidgetsに指示する最もクリーンな方法は何ですか?
- 24. cntlmを使用するようにGitを指す方法
- 25. LinqをOracleに使用する方法はありますか
- 26. ストアドプロシージャサポートで使用するテストデータベース
- 27. std ::を 'リフレッシュ'するように指示する方法?
- 28. ASP.NETでストアドプロシージャを使用するより良い方法はありますか?
- 29. will_paginateでヘルパーメソッドを使用するより良い方法はありますか?
- 30. ライト出力を使用するときにフォントの色を指定する方法はありますか